Hi, can anyone advise on a material or a tool that could used to check the fuel level by putting it down the emulsion tube of a carb.
Its a Solex C40 PAAI.
The workshop manual suggests using sight-glass that screws into base of float chamber - but I'd have to make one as none available.

I use a narrow cable tie marked with a datum which lines with the top of the emulsion tube. The fuel wicks into the serrations of the tie. Accurate to the serration interval.
